Transaction 768e530e1a160e52078550f01e0d1a7b3ee70310ac1675d74b2f912842f5b5e7

4 Input
2 Outputs
  • 768e530e1a160e52078550f01e0d1a7b3ee70310ac1675d74b2f912842f5b5e7:0
  • value  14402277
    address  38WdSRQ1PvPJj2T9u3whAuWmDeZsYSXGvD
  • 768e530e1a160e52078550f01e0d1a7b3ee70310ac1675d74b2f912842f5b5e7:1
  • value  43151
    address  1GXu2auyXgnF7pLYarhgoW3WTaLfWQoYnB